  • Iron oxide copper gold ore deposits

    These ore bodies range from around 10 million to >4,000 million tonnes of contained ore, and have a grade of between 0.2% and 5% copper, with gold contents ranging from 0.1 to 1.41 grams per tonne. These ore bodies tend to express as cone-like, blanket-like breccia sheets within granitic margins, or as long ribbon-like breccia or massive iron oxide deposits within faults or shears.

  • The process mineralogy of gold: The classification of ore types

    The principal gold minerals that affect the processing of gold ores are native gold, electrum, Au-Ag tellurides, aurostibite, maldonite, and auricupride. In addition, submicroscopic (solid solution) gold, principally in arsenopyrite and pyrite, is also important.   • Copper Mining and Processing: Processing Copper Ores

    In addition to processing copper ores, new and old copper scrap or copper alloys can be melted, re-purified, and recycled into new components. It is estimated that such recycling supplies 50% of copper used in the copper industry (Scott, 2011). In 2010, 770,000 metric tons of copper were recycled, at an estimated value of nearly six billion dollars (Papp, 2010).

  • How to Calculate Grade and Recovery with Examples

    For example, a copper ore grade of 1% means that in 100 tons of the ore, we have 1 ton of copper. If the copper ore contains 40 tons of calcite gangue, we can also say 40% of calcite in the ore. A gold deposit with a grade equal to 5 g/t (gram per ton) means that in one ton of the ore, we have 5 grams of gold.
